How To Fix G06017 - Cannot allocate sender group for organizational change number &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: G06 - SAP Cons - Error Message re. Consolidation of Investments

  • Message number: 017

  • Message text: Cannot allocate sender group for organizational change number &1

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    No sender group could be assigned to receiver group &V4& for
    organizational change with number &V1& during activity &V2& of investee
    unit &V3&.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    In the Customizing of consolidation for organizational change number
    &V1&, maintain the sender-receiver relationship for receiver group &V4&.
